Have a home ispection but Beware
Contributed by: Terry Shattuck on 2/5/2007

Protect yourself; get a home inspection. But beware.

Home inspectors are not required to be licensed in Colorado. Anyone, can go into business tomorrow, and call himself a home inspector, whether or not he has any qualifications. He can even fool you into believing he is qualified, by presenting a "certification" from some bogus organization with an official sounding name, which sells certifications. As a Realtor with over 20 years experience, I have seen a lot of very worthless home inspections, and hope you will use your head when hiring an inspector. I personally would not use anyone not certified by The American Society of Home Inspectors (ASHI). You can find their members by looking for the ASHI logo in their ads. Also, always insist that the inspector be insured and bonded and that he carries Errors and Omissions insurance.

At the same time, remember that if you are buying an older home, that it is bound to have some flaws. The purpose of an inspection is to discover hidden flaws that are significant in nature. Obviously, you don't want to find out, after you have bought a home, that it has serious issues, which you did not know about. An inspection should not be seen as a device to "renegotiate" after the fact. It is really crude and dishonorable to get sellers to take their home off the market for a few weeks, while you get an inspection, and then turn around and renegotiate on the basis of minor flaws or things that you could have easily known about going into the negotiations.

As a Seller, it is a very good idea to have a pre-inspection so you have a good idea as to what buyers will find when they have their inspection. Why not have a chance to correct defects ahead of time or at least be able to address them. There is nothing worse than losing a deal at the last minute, because of a few defects.
